Ejemplo n.º 1
0
        /**
         * inputStreamからARToolKit形式のパターンデータを指定サイズで読み出して、格納したインスタンスを生成します。
         * ロードするパターンデータの縦横解像度は、このインスタンスの値と同じである必要があります。
         * @param i_stream
         * 読出し元のStreamオブジェクト
         * @param i_width
         * パターンの幅pixel数。データの内容と一致している必要があります。
         * @param i_height
         * パターンの幅pixel数。データの内容と一致している必要があります。
         * @throws NyARException
         */
        public static NyARCode createFromARPattFile(StreamReader i_stream, int i_width, int i_height)
        {
            //ラスタにパターンをロードする。
            NyARCode ret = new NyARCode(i_width, i_height);

            NyARCodeFileReader.loadFromARToolKitFormFile(i_stream, ret);
            return(ret);
        }
Ejemplo n.º 2
0
 /**
  * inputStreamから、パターンデータをロードします。
  * ロードするパターンのサイズは、現在の値と同じである必要があります。
  * @param i_stream
  * @throws NyARException
  */
 public void loadARPatt(StreamReader i_stream)
 {
     //ラスタにパターンをロードする。
     NyARCodeFileReader.loadFromARToolKitFormFile(i_stream, this);
     return;
 }